Short-lived Hearst magazine, with Helen Gurley Brown of Cosmopolitan fame as supervising editor, aimed at the counter- culture or hippie movement of the 1960s. Features include Jim Morrison of The Doors rapping with himself and an article about screenwriter Buck Henry by Nora Ephron before her own screenwriting career took off.
